Actually, if you run anything and logout, it will be killed after a timeout. The way to prevent this in systemd land is to enable-linger for that user.
IMO this is a pretty sane default and it's easy enough to disable for users
EDIT: For non-root users
@InnerScientist This might be good behaviour (especially on shared multiuser system)
But how often you using shared multiuser systems in 2025? In 2015? In 2010 this might be useful, but now we are using containers instead.
When you have single root user, single unpriveleged user and few service users, such behaviour is just useless. If interactive user left some services running, it's usually intentional. And systemd requires notify about this intention every time. Why? It's just useless complexity.
Systemd requires a one time fee of
loginctl enable-linger myserviceuserto never kill processes with a timeout for that user again. This behavior also doesn't affect system users, only normal users.I think the main purpose nowadays is to stop pipewire and other user services that don't need to consume resources when that user isn't logged in

Some people think it handles too many low-level systems. It's a valid concern because if systemd itself were to become compromised (like Xz Utils was) or a serious bug was introduced, all of the userland processes would be affected. People who are stuck in the 90s and think that the Unix philosophy is still relevant will also point out that it's a needlessly complex software suite and we should all go back to writing initscripts in bash.
Red Hat, the owner of systemd, has also had its fair share of controversies. It's a company that many distrust.
Ultimately, those whose opinion mattered the most decided that systemd's benefits outweigh the risks and drawbacks. Debian held a vote to determine the project's future regarding init systems. Arch Linux replaced initscripts because systemd was simply better, and replicating and maintaining its features (like starting services once their dependencies are running) with initscripts would've been unjustifiably complicated.

Yeah, it doesn't actually make much of a difference:
Fundamentally the idea of having a separate admin account, which is completely protected, and a user account where everything can mingle together and see everything else, is a 1960s security model. It was originally created for a world where the owner of the computer and the user of the computer were two different people. In that world the user provides all the software that they want to run in their account (they probably wrote it) and the OS's job is to protect the admin account from users and the users from each other.
Fast forward to the present day and this security model is completely mismatched with the reality of a personal computer. The internet exists, the user and owner are the same person, and they're probably not writing all their software themselves. A piece of malicious or compromised software can encrypt every file in your user folder, steal your browser history, your saved passwords, and (on xwindows) record your keystrokes and make your screen display anything it wants, all without privilege escalation. But you can rest assured knowing that the user account can't violate any timeshare limits that the root account placed on it.
The one thing you could argue is that a separate admin account makes it easier to detect and fix a compromised user account, but:
Most people are not in the habit of regularly logging into their root account and examining all the processes that are running in their user account. In fact many distributions do not even have a separate root account.
If you do think your computer has been compromised the sensible thing is to wipe the disk and restore from backup. It just doesn't make any sense to fiddle around trying to figure out just how compromised you are and trying to reverse the process in a running system.
If you're running xwindows I hope you never install updates or type your password for any other reason while some malicious software is running, since, as previously stated, anything running under your account can record your keystrokes. In that case your admin account is compromised anyway without having to use any privilege escalation exploits. Can you see how all this stuff was built with the assumption that the user and owner are two separate people with two separate passwords?
With Wayland and containerized applications we are slowly moving away from that 1960s security posture, which is something that's long overdo. But currently something like Linux Mint is not really much better off than Haiku, from a pure security model standpoint.

My favorite is Debian, with systemd uninstalled. At this point, you can't install Debian without systemd, but you can uninstall systemd after OS installation.
It used to be that most desktop environments in Debian depended on libpam-systemd, which depended on systemd and systemd-sysv. More recently, desktop environments just depend on libpam-elogind and elogind which is only part of systemd, and allows you to use sysvinit.
I prefer sysvinit mainly because I find it easier to create custom services out of my own programs. My success rate at doing this in systemd is 1/3, and in sysvinit about 10/10.
I also had a problem where a Debian-based embedded system had some kind of broken NTP client running on startup, and due to systemd, I couldn't figure out how to disable it. It would set the time to several years into the future, as soon as it first got a network connection on each startup.

After having a lot of sysvinit experience, the transition to setting up my own systemd services has been brutal. What finally clicked for me was that I had this habit of building mini-services based on shellscripts; and systemd goes out of its way to deliberately break those: it wants a single stable process to monitor; and if it sniffs out that you are doing some sketchy things that forks in ways it disapproves of, it is going to shut the whole thing down.
